A1 truth table ci 1 0 0 0 1 0 1 1 1 a b ci co 0000 truth table b1 ci1 0010 0100 0111 1011 1101 co 1111 tthtruth tbltable to k. Difficult to tell when you have arrived at a minimum solution. By minimization we imply a function with minimum number of terms and each term with lowest number of literals. Kmap is directly applied to twolevel networks composed of and and or gates. Maurice karnaugh introduced it in 1953 as a refinement of. Because of this, items can be grouped together easily in rectangular blocks of two, four, and eight to. Karnaugh maps kmaps an nvariable kmap has 2n cells with each cell corresponding to an nvariable truth table value. This package draws karnaugh maps with 2, 3, 4, 5, and 6 variables. Kmap cells are arranged such that adjacent cells correspond to truth rows that differ in only one bit position logical adjacency. The cells are arranged in a way so that simplification of a given expression is simply a matter of properly grouping the cells. The karnaugh map, also known as the k map, is a method to simplify boolean algebra expressions.
Kmap cells are labeled with the corresponding truthtable row. For any entered variable kmap, thinking of or actually sketching the submaps can help identify the correct encoding for the entered variables.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. Groups must contain 1, 2, 4, 8, or in general 2 n cells. Construct minterm and maxterm from a compressed kmap. Logic design unit 5 karnaugh map sauhsuan wu a five variable map can be constructed in 3 dimensions by placing one four variable map on top of a second one terms in the bottom layer are numbered 0 through 15 terms in the top layer are numbered 16 through 31 terms in the top or bottom layer combine just like terms on a four variable map. A function f which has maximum decimal value of 63, can be defined and simplified by a 6 variable karnaugh map. Digital electronics and logic design tutorials geeksforgeeks.
The older version of the five variable k map, a gray code map or reflection map, is shown above. Reflection map the 5 variable reflection map that uses gray code refer to section 5. In addition, the cterminal region contains several repetitions of the motif cx 2cx nhc where n is variable, thus showing similarity to the socalled dhhcmotif found in. Therefore, there are 8 cells in a 3 variable k map.
We will begin by introducing kmaps of 2 variables, and continue with kmaps of higher complexity. Last minute notes lmns quizzes on digital electronics and logic design. A minterm represents exacly one combination of the binary variables in. In above boolean table, from 0 to 15, a is 0 and from 16 to 31, a is 1. A graphical technique for simplifying an expression into a minimal sum. How to deal with an 8 variable karnaugh map stack exchange. There are two possibilities of grouping 16 adjacent min terms. Logic design unit 5 karnaugh map sauhsuan wu a fivevariable map can be constructed in 3 dimensions by placing one fourvariable map on top of a second one terms in the bottom layer are numbered 0 through 15 terms in the top layer are numbered 16 through 31 terms in the top or bottom layer combine just like terms on a fourvariable map.
A bunch of boolean algebra trickery for simplifying expressions and circuits. The 3variable kmap b the 3variable kmap is created much the same way as the 2variable kmap with one major difference. Since function f has 4 variables so we will create a 4 variable kmap having 2 4 16 cells. N6benzyladenine and kinetin influence antioxidative. By using this protocol, a highresolution transcriptomewide human m 6 a map and genomewide chlamydomonas 6ma map were obtained, providing new insights into the distribution and biological functions of the m 6 a6ma. The karnaugh map reduces the need for extensive calculations by taking advantage of humans patternrecognition capability. With 38 listings in friendly n6 route, our handy friendly n6 route map search and great low prices, its easy to book the perfect holiday accommodation for your friendly n6. K map cells are arranged such that adjacent cells correspond to truth rows that differ in only one bit position logical adjacency. This is done to allow only one variable to change across adjacent cells. In this tutorial we will learn to reduce product of sums pos using karnaugh map.
The karnaugh map km or k map is a method of simplifying boolean algebra expressions. Department of electrical engineering and computer sciences cs150 fall 2001 prof. I was doing this program to simplify the 4 variable kmap. Karnaugh map k map allows viewing the function in a picture form. The top and side for a 6 variable map of the map is numbered in full gray code. The older version of the five variable kmap, a gray code map or reflection map, is shown above. The overlay version of the karnaugh map, shown above, is simply two four for a 6 variable map identical maps except for the most significant bit of the 3bit address across the top. The karnaugh map km or kmap is a method of simplifying boolean algebra expressions. The kmap for 3 variables is plotted next, you will notice the columns for 11 and 10 are interchanged. N6benzyladenine and kinetin are adeninetype cytokinins that play various roles in many aspects of plant development and stimulate anabolic processes in plant cells.
Groups may be horizontal or vertical, but not diagonal. The largest subcube in a twovariable map is a 1cube, which represents a single variable or its complement. A kmap can be created directly from a truth table each square of the kmap corresponds to one row of the truth table a logic 1 is entered when the function is 1 a logic 0 is entered when the function is 0. N6methyladenosine an overview sciencedirect topics. Kmap cells are arranged such that adjacent cells correspond to truth rows that. I have an 8 variable input, and i remember that i should try and make the selections a big as. For bigger situations, give each boolean variable a meaningful name. This property of gray code is often useful for digital electronics in general.
After installment of the chemical mark, it can be read by an array of m 6 aspecific reader proteins in the nucleus as well as the cytoplasm. The program works fine except for minterm combinations that contain the first minterm in the code m0. A function f which has maximum decimal value of 31, can be defined and simplified by a 5 variable karnaugh map. The positive training data m 6 a sites was determined as the m 6 a sites under rrach consensus motifs that have been reproduced in at least two of the five training datasets. Karnaugh map welcome to the school of engineering and.
It also contains commands for filling the karnaugh map with terms semi automatically or. The gray code reflects about the middle of the code. Introduction of kmap karnaugh map in many digital circuits and practical problems we need to find expression with minimum variables. Note the logic values along the top of the map below representing y and z. For those of you who didnt understand what i was talking about, here is a 8 variable karnaugh map. Cse 271 introduction to digital systems supplementary. The karnaugh map, also known as the kmap, is a method to simplify boolean algebra expressions.
With regression diagnostics, researchers now have an accessible explanation of the techniques needed for exploring problems that compromise a regression anal. Molv nih3t3 fibroblasts and j1 embryonic stem es cells were obtained by crisprcas9 genome editing using a plasmid coding for a high fidelity cas9 protein vp12, a bpk1520 addgenederived plasmid where suitable guide rnas grna were cloned into, and a construct coding for the neomycin resistance gene flanked by. Probabilistic systems analysis fall 2010 a find the normalization constant c. Let us move on to some examples of simplification with 3 variable karnaugh maps. Introduce the concept of dont care entries and show how to extend karnaugh map techniques to include maps with dont care entries. Stroud combinational logic minimization 912 2 karnaugh maps kmap alternate forms of 3 variable k maps note endaround adjacency. Karnaugh map method2 variable kmap and 3 variable k. This wellestablished strategy is reproducible and widely applicable to other biological systems for highthroughput sequencing. K map is directly applied to twolevel networks composed of and and or gates. Karnaugh map method2 variable kmap and 3 variable kmap. Karnaugh map kmap can be used to minimize functions of up to 6 variables.
Lecture 6 karnaugh map kmap university of washington. First we will cover the rules step by step then we will solve problem. Logic simplification with karnaugh maps karnaugh mapping. Lecture 6 karnaugh maps kmaps kmaps with dont cares 2 karnaugh map k map flat representation of boolean cubes easy to use for 2 4 dimensions harder for 5 6 dimensions virtually impossible for 6 dimensions use cad tools help visualize adjacencies onset elements that have one variable changing are adjacent 3 karnaugh map. It is 8km north of the city of london, and contains highgate, parliament hill, dartmouth park, and queens wood. Show how to use karnaugh maps to derive minimal sumofproducts and productofsums expressions. We can minimize boolean expressions of 3, 4 variables very easily using k map without using any boolean algebra theorems.
Looping entered variable kmaps follows the same general principles as looping 10 mapsoptimal groupings of 1s and entered variables evs are sought for sop circuits, and optimal groupings of 0s and evs are sought for pos circuits. Karnaugh maps k maps a karnugh map is a graphical representation of a truth table the map contains one cell for each possible minterm adjacent cells differ in only one literal, i. Now fill the cell marked with subscript 0,1,2,4,5,7,10 and 15 with value 0 as we are dealing with product of sums pos. Karnaugh map kmap allows viewing the function in a picture form.
Instead of gathering terms using a graphical technique like a karnaugh. Practice problems on digital electronics and logic design. Genomic features 1 are dummy variable features indicating whether the adenosine sites shall fall within the transcript regions that satisfy certain topological properties. It can furthermore be actively removed by alkbh5 or fto, the two characterized m 6 a demethylases.
Singlemolecule sequencing detection of n6methyladenine in microbial reference materials article pdf available in nature communications 101 december 2019 with 141 reads how we measure reads. There is only one possibility of grouping 32 adjacent min terms. K map cells are labeled with the corresponding truthtable row. Maurice karnaugh introduced it in 1953 as a refinement of edward veitchs 1952 veitch chart, which actually was a rediscovery of allan marquands 1881 logical diagram aka marquand diagram but with a focus now set on its utility for switching circuits. N6 is a postcode district, also known as an outcode or outbound code. Karnaugh maps k maps an n variable k map has 2n cells with each cell corresponding to an n variable truth table value. There are a couple of rules that we use to reduce pos using k map. Then when you have a moderately complex boolean expression, hopefully its meaning will be obvious by inspection.
The karnaugh map uses the following rules for the simplification of expressions by grouping together adjacent cells containing ones. Karnaugh map location of minterms in kmaps simplification using. In the above all k maps, we used exclusively the min. If we look at the top of the map, we will see that the numbering is different from the previous gray code map. Now, due to this, the four 1 s in the map can be grouped into a single group of four where the variable a falls out of the expression vertically and the variable b falls out horizontally. The aim of this study was to examine the effect of n6benzyladenine and kinetin on basic.
Cse 271 introduction to digital systems supplementary reading an example of kmap with five variables consider the logic function with 5 input variables. Five variable karnaugh map there are several different formats of a 5 variable k map of which we discuss two most popular ones in this book. Karnaugh maps and truth tables and logical expressions. In the beginning of the performance evaluation procedure, dataset 6 of the baseresolution data table table1 1 was used as the independent testing data, while the other five datasets were used as the training data. The cells are arranged in a way so that simplification of a given expression is. One important thing to note is that k maps follow the gray code sequence, not the binary one.
Note that truth table row numbers can be mapped to cells in the submaps by reading the kmap index codes, starting with the supermap code, and. Massachusetts institutechnology of te department of. The product term in a canonical sop expression is called a minterm. Apr 23, 2019 hence, we generated 35 additional genomic features that may contribute to the prediction. The largest subcube in a two variable map is a 1cube, which represents a single variable or its complement. If v0, then 5 variable k map becomes 4 variable k map. For kvariable maps, this reduction technique can also be applied. Using gray code arrangement ensures that minterms of adjacent cells differ by only one literal. We show how to map the product terms of the unsimplified logic to the k map. One important thing to note is that kmaps follow the gray code sequence, not the binary one. Given the following fsm diagram of a mealey machine, write the state transition table. Induction of sporulation in saccharomyces cerevisiae leads to the formation of n6methyladenosine in mrna. The top and side for a 6variable map of the map is numbered in full gray code.
If you are looking for friendly n6 route holiday accommodation, safarinow has a selection of selfcatering, bed and breakfast, guest house holiday accommodation in friendly n6 route and surrounds. Please write comments if you find anything incorrect, or you want to share more information about the topic discussed above. Now any adjacent 1, 2, 4 or 8 cells can be grouped to find a minimized logic. This placement in columns allows the minimization of logic. Oct 20, 2015 this feature is not available right now. Product of sums reduction using karnaugh map boolean. Boolean table for 6 variables is quite big, so we have shown only values, where there is a noticeable change in values which will help us to draw the k map. Three variables karnaugh map minimization k map discussion with examples. Stroud combinational logic minimization 912 2 karnaugh maps k map alternate forms of 3variable kmaps note endaround adjacency.
268 473 1020 509 858 568 1154 246 866 353 1280 1027 715 1475 1177 1195 61 1388 337 1337 1471 490 23 1430 580 982 1197 1193 1070 1253 1318 985